Hey Marit,

Handing off the Keythresher rotation utility before I'm out next week. It runs nightly against the Bramblevault store and rotates anything older than 30 days. The dry-run flag actually works now, so use it before the release cut. One gotcha: if the rotation job dies mid-batch, it locks its own state file and you'll need the recovery passphrase to unseal it. Writing it here so you're not stuck at 2am:

strongbox words: wenix-ulador

Subject: Swapping out the old job queue

Hey Marisol,

Quick heads-up before the Thursday cut: we're finally retiring the homegrown queue in Lanternbox and moving everything to Driftline's hosted worker pool. Retries and dead-lettering now come for free, so we can delete about 900 lines of cron glue. Your team just needs to repoint the enqueue calls at the new endpoint. For staging access, use the following bearer token.

session JWT of hahif-fawif = eyJhbGciOiJIUzI1NiIsInR5cCI6IkpXVCJ9.eyJzdWIiOiI04_V2KayaDIn0.-jKHPhS5t5LS

# Environment Variables — Shrinkly CLI

Shrinkly, our batch image-resizing CLI, reads all configuration from a `.env` file in the working directory. `SHRINKLY_MAX_WORKERS` caps parallel resize jobs (default 4). `SHRINKLY_OUTPUT_DIR` sets where resized assets land. `SHRINKLY_FORMAT` forces an output format; leave unset to preserve source format. Uploads to the Cobblepond asset store require authentication, and the CLI refuses to start batch mode without it. The store credential goes on the next line of the file.

sealed setting: ARCHIVE_KEY3=8d0

- [ ] **Step 7: Breaker override escrow.** After sealing the signing keys for the Tallgrove upstream API circuit breaker, confirm the support team can force the breaker open during a full outage. The override bundle lives in the sealed escrow drawer and is useless without its unlock phrase. Two ceremony witnesses must initial this step before proceeding. The escrow bundle is decrypted with the recovery passphrase that follows.

vault phrase of kahip-kahop = holath-quenmir